Position Summary:

Assists therapists and therapy assistants in performance of daily patient treatment programs. Is responsible for cleaning and simple maintenance of equipment. Assists with maintenance of department inventory and ordering of general departmental supplies. Escorting patients and performance of some basic clerical duties may be required.

Assists therapists in the provision of patient care.

Responsible for equipment and supply inventory management including ordering, maintenance logs and cleaning schedules.

Supports the Office Coordinator and Clerk/Receptionists with front office duties including faxing, answering phones, checking billing.

Completes special projects and tasks assigned by supervisors and therapists to facilitate the smooth running of therapy services.

Projects a positive attitude and demeanor with patients and colleagues fostering a remarkable patient experience.

Qualifications:

Knowledge of rehabilitation outpatient and inpatient settings preferred .

Basic knowledge of the use of physical agents and modalities in the provision of patient care preferred.

Computer skills with Microsoft applications preferred: Word, Excel and PowerPoint.

Genuine affinity of customer service required.

1-2 years related experience in a healthcare setting preferred.

Education:

High school diploma or GED required.

Certification:

Current BCLS certification required
